Why We Like The Fjallraven Kajka 65L Backpack
Carry more gear with less hassle thanks to the easy-hauling, smooth-hiking Kajka 65 Backpack from Fjallraven. With easy adjustments throughout the torso and hip belt, this pack makes it easy to dial in a comfortable fit on the trail or at home. Three different access points to the main compartment mean we have no trouble storing and accessing our gear quickly. When we need to make a quick summit bid, the top cover can easily be converted into a waist or chest bag for lightweight hauling. A reflective rain cover and durable outer fabric let the pack stand up to the abuses of life on the trail.
Details
- Polyester and vinyl outer material offer rugged weather protection
- Perfect Fit Adjustment suspension system dials in fit for all trekkers
- Ergonomic-shaped shoulder straps feature whistle on chest strap
- Dual-access main compartment for convenient access to pack contents
- Top cover converts to waist or chest bag for day hikes
- Reflective rain cover built-in to provide visibility and coverage in gray conditions

kajka 65 backpack
i bought the 75l backpack for winter backpacking after trying lundhags and osprey versions .i tried the kajka, instantly knew this was the one to survive Scotlands granite rocks , after months of continual use summer came all to.fast i realised 75 was great for winter gear . i was going to struggle to fill.the cavernous main chamber , so i bought the 65 L backpack for summer ,i go away for months at a time so the side pockets hold a full weeks suply of expedition foods 1000 cal meals ,without interfering with the main compartment , and the top from my 75l pack can carry other bits as a chest rig if needed , awesomly comfy and adjustable , this is the one to beat , hands down

Amazing pack, on my second one!
This pack is amazing, I used it to hike the Appalachian trail in 2019. It held up when all the other packs tore and broke. It always felt comfortable and carried 40 pounds daily with ease. The compression rods and the birch frame made it easy to pack and comfortable to carry.
